From dfaf4569a5e590410330de77a5289af8456110fc Mon Sep 17 00:00:00 2001 From: Anthony Rodriguez Date: Thu, 7 Nov 2024 18:25:44 +0100 Subject: [PATCH] treewide: add gnome config to solaire --- home/programs/gnome/default.nix | 3 ++- hosts/solaire/default.nix | 1 + hosts/solaire/modules/theme.nix | 2 +- 3 files changed, 4 insertions(+), 2 deletions(-) diff --git a/home/programs/gnome/default.nix b/home/programs/gnome/default.nix index 3f5270f..005da1a 100644 --- a/home/programs/gnome/default.nix +++ b/home/programs/gnome/default.nix @@ -1,5 +1,6 @@ { pkgs, + osConfig, config, ... }: { @@ -25,7 +26,7 @@ color-scheme = "prefer-dark"; }; "org/gnome/desktop/background" = { - picture-uri-dark = "file://" + builtins.toString config.style.wallpaper; + picture-uri-dark = "file://" + builtins.toString osConfig.theme.wallpaper; }; "org/gnome/desktop/search-providers" = { diff --git a/hosts/solaire/default.nix b/hosts/solaire/default.nix index 3f489c5..f19bfcd 100644 --- a/hosts/solaire/default.nix +++ b/hosts/solaire/default.nix @@ -20,6 +20,7 @@ in { "${home}/programs/games" "${home}/terminal/emulators/foot.nix" + "${home}/programs/gnome" ]; extraSpecialArgs = specialArgs; }; diff --git a/hosts/solaire/modules/theme.nix b/hosts/solaire/modules/theme.nix index a9e9745..a1c7e7e 100644 --- a/hosts/solaire/modules/theme.nix +++ b/hosts/solaire/modules/theme.nix @@ -1,3 +1,3 @@ { - theme.wallpaper = ../../wallpapers/lucy-edgerunners-wallpaper.jpg; + theme.wallpaper = ../../../wallpapers/lucy-edgerunners-wallpaper.jpg; }